Dallas Origin and Destination Survey
Survey created by the Texas Highway Department in conjunction with the "City and County of Dallas" concerning the "major external routes of vehicular travel radiating from Dallas." The survey asked drivers where their trip began, which roads they traveled on, and their destination. This report includes tables and maps showing the compiled data and the various traffic movements around the city.
[Lake Cliff Park & Pool]
Photograph of an aerial view of the large rectangular with a permanent pavilion in the Lake Cliff pool. People line the edges of the swimming pool in various forms of relaxation enjoying the August weather. A kayak is visible in the middle of the pool paddling around. Trees obscure the edges of the pool's boundary giving shade to sprawled out pool goers. A small parking lot with 1945 era cars are visible in the bottom right of the photograph. In the background of the photograph a baseball diamond featuring spectators and players are visible.
A Master Plan for Dallas, Texas, Report 9: Zoning
Report providing information about the ongoing city planning for Dallas, Texas that started with the Kessler Plan in 1911. This report includes discussions on new zoning regulations and various land uses; the report is broken into five parts: "District Regulations; Locations of the Districts; Area of the Proposed Districts; Major Features of Text of the Proposed Ordinance; Administration of the Ordinance."
A Master Plan for Dallas, Texas, Report 11: Public Buildings
Report providing information about the ongoing city planning for Dallas, Texas that started with the Kessler Plan in 1911. This report includes information regarding public buildings in the Dallas, Texas and the development of future buildings; the maps show plans for the development of a municipal center, and street improvements.
The Master Plan for Dallas, Texas, Report 14: A Preliminary Report Upon a Capital Expenditure Program
Report providing information about the ongoing city planning for Dallas, Texas that started with the Kessler Plan in 1911. This report includes details concerning a capital expenditure program, such as the allocation of funds, selection of projects and a "[p]roposed 25 Year Program of General Fund Public Improvements. The second part of the report details an improvement program for the water and sanitary sewer systems. The appendix at the end of the report includes 17 tables providing empirical data about the proposed plans.
A Master Plan for Dallas, Texas: Water and Sanitary Sewer Utilities
Report providing information about the ongoing city planning for Dallas, Texas that started with the Kessler Plan in 1911. This report includes graphs, charts, and maps concerning the development of an improved water and sanitary sewer system; at the back of the report there are maps showing predicted urban development and the Dallas water distribution system.

[Water and Sewage Development Plan Prepared by Dallas City Water Works]
Rough draft of a plan created by Dallas City Waterworks attempting to improve the "water and sanitary sewer utilities serving the Dallas Metropolitan Area." There are charts and graphs throughout the document, including five tables in the back.
